§ 43-2-211 — Cattle guards - specifications
The board of county
commissioners of a county has authority to establish cattle guards on highways at
the expense of the county or to permit the owners of land adjoining a county
highway to establish cattle guards on highways at the expense of the landowners.
All such cattle guards shall be established according to fixed specifications and
design and under the supervision of the board of county commissioners.
